Cervical Spinal System
Indications:
Occipito-cervical, atlantoaxial instability, cervical spinal stenosis,
cervical spine fracture, dislocation, vertebral body tumor, infection, lesions at the cervicothoracic junction,
and other conditions requiring combined anterior and posterior surgical treatment
Features:
Upper cervical vertebra screw with polished rod to avoid harassment of surrounding soft tissue
The bottom of the nail base is open, so that the screw has a larger movable angle, which is convenient for placing the rod
Provide cortical bone and cancellous bone screws, which is convenient for doctors to choose pedicle and lateral mass screw
